- Doctor metering system for an apparatus for coating material webs (1), in particular paper or board webs, comprising a metering bar (3) as a metering element, which is held in a groove of a doctor bed (4), which is mounted in a holder (6) that can be fixed in the frame of the system,
characterizedin that the metering bar (3) has a diameter of less than 25 mm,the doctor bed (4) is inserted into a groove (18) in the holder (6) such that it can be removed at the front side of the latter, the ratio of the cross-sectional area (measured in mm2) of the doctor bed (4) to the diameter (measured in mm) of the metering bar (3) being less than 60 mm, preferably less than 30 mm,the holder (6) is fabricated from a plastic material and is configured in the manner of a clamp having at least one clamp limb (13, 14) extending rearwards and a hinge point (15), the holder groove (18) that accommodates the doctor bed (4) forming the mouth of the clamp, anda clamping hose (16) that presses the groove walls of the holder groove (18) towards each other being arranged on one clamp limb (13). - Doctor metering system according to Claim 1, characterized in that on the rear of the holder (6) there is arranged a pressure hose (12) which is supported on the frame of the system and presses the holder (6) in the direction of the doctor bed (4).
- Doctor metering system according to Claim 1 or 2, characterized in that the ratio of the cross-sectional area (measured in mm2) of the doctor bed (4) to the diameter (measured in mm) of the metering bar (3) is 10 mm to 25 mm.
- Doctor metering system according to one of Claims 1 to 3, characterized in that the diameter of the metering bar (3) is less than/equal to 16 mm and the cross-sectional area of the doctor bed (4) is 100 mm2 to 400 mm2.
- Doctor metering system according to one of Claims 1 to 4, characterized in that the opening in the groove (18) of the holder (6) is bounded by at least one protrusion (19), preferably two protrusions (19), and the doctor bed (4) has a corresponding number of widened portions (20) which, when the doctor bed (4) is inserted into the holder (6), are moved behind the protrusion (19) or the protrusions (19).
- Doctor metering system according to one of Claims 1 to 5, characterized in that the doctor bed (4) embraces an inserted metering bar (3) by at least 180°.
- Doctor metering system according to one of Claims 1 to 6, characterized in that the doctor bed (4) and/or the holder (6) is/are fabricated from an elastomer, preferably polyurethane, having a hardness between 50 Shore A and 65 Shore D.
- Doctor metering system according to one of Claims 1 to 6, characterized in that the doctor bed (4) and/or the holder (6) is/are fabricated from polyethylene, which has been machined by removing material.
- Doctor metering system according to one of Claims 1 to 8, characterized in that the doctor bed is fabricated from a resilient material.
- Doctor metering system according to one of Claims 1 to 9, characterized in that, as a hinge point (15), a region of the holder (6) between the clamping hose (16) and the holder groove (18) is formed as a weak point with a reduced thickness.
- Doctor metering system according to Claim 10, characterized in that the thickness of the holder (6) at the weak point, measured radially towards the metering bar (3) in the direction of the clamping hose (16), is 0.5 mm to 10 mm, preferably 1 mm to 3 mm.
